Wildfires rage in Northern California

Wildfires rage in Northern California
Flames are seen on both sides of Lake Berryessa in this long-exposure photo taken in Napa, California, on Tuesday. Josh Edelson/AFP/Getty Images

California is in a state of emergency as dozens of fast-moving fires, many triggered by lightning strikes during an extreme heatwave have spread across the north and centre of the state.

The fires are threatening homes and causing the evacuation of thousands of people.

There are at least 77 large complexes of wildfires burning in 15 states across the US, almost a third of them in California.

The fires have burned at least 649,054 acres in the 14 states where fires are still spreading.

Some 45 million people remain under some sort of heat warning or advisories.

Most of California and some surrounding areas are under an excessive heat warning from the National Weather Service.
